AT&T Pantech Reveal Reviews

Posted: 26 Oct 2009 08:07 AM PDT

The pantech Reveal is a new messaging phone for AT&T like the pantech Matrix and pantech matrix pro, it is also a slim slider, but it has a completely different design. In fact, it’s a style we haven’t seen before. It looks like a normal candy bar phone on the front, but if you slide it up vertically, you’ll reveal a full QWERTY keyboard underneath the number keypad. Most slider messaging phones have the QWERTY keyboard on the side instead. In addtion, the Reveal is one of the first phones to come preloaded with AT&T’s new HTML mobile browser and att.net home page, which combines the best of full and fast HTML browsing with custom features for personalizing favorite bookmarks and local searches. However, the Pantech Reveal’s QWERTY keyboard is a little cramped, if you have are big finger, I think you had better not choose it. What’s worse, the device’s screen is too samll so that we have to scroll though Web pages a lot more.
